Entry Level Cloud Architect Compensation Benchmarks Across Indian Technology Markets

Professionals entering cloud architecture roles for the first time in India — typically those with two to four years of general cloud engineering experience who have recently earned their first professional-level cloud certification — can expect compensation that already places them significantly above the median technology professional salary in the Indian market. Entry-level cloud architect positions in India’s primary technology employment centers, including Bangalore, Hyderabad, Pune, Chennai, and the National Capital Region encompassing Delhi and Gurgaon, typically offer annual compensation packages ranging from approximately eight lakhs to sixteen lakhs per annum for professionals who combine relevant certification credentials with foundational practical experience in cloud environments.

The variation within this entry-level range reflects several factors that significantly influence starting compensation even for professionals at comparable experience levels. Employer type plays a major role — global product companies and multinational technology firms with India development centers typically offer compensation at the higher end of the entry-level range, while Indian technology services companies and domestic enterprises may offer somewhat lower base salaries but frequently compensate with other benefits including structured learning and development programs, international project exposure, and clearly defined advancement pathways. Certification portfolio matters considerably at the entry level, where formal credentials provide employers with the most reliable signal of knowledge quality in the absence of extensive professional experience. Professionals who arrive at entry-level cloud architecture roles with multiple cloud platform certifications across providers including AWS, Azure, and Google Cloud command meaningfully better compensation than those with single-platform credentials alone.

Mid Career Cloud Architect Salary Ranges For Experienced Professionals In India

The most substantial compensation growth in a cloud architecture career typically occurs during the mid-career phase, when professionals have accumulated five to ten years of total technology experience with three to six years of focused cloud architecture work. At this career stage, a cloud architect’s market value is determined primarily by the depth and complexity of the cloud environments they have designed and managed, the specific technical domains in which they have developed specialized expertise, and the tangible business outcomes their architectural decisions have produced for previous employers. Mid-career cloud architects in India’s major technology hubs command annual compensation packages that commonly range from eighteen lakhs to forty-five lakhs per annum, with the highest figures in this range reserved for professionals with particularly strong specialization credentials and documented records of delivering complex cloud transformation programs.

Several technical specializations within cloud architecture command premium compensation at the mid-career level that significantly exceeds the general cloud architect market. Professionals who have developed deep expertise in cloud security architecture are among the most sought after and best compensated within the broader cloud architecture talent pool, reflecting the acute organizational urgency around protecting cloud environments from increasingly sophisticated threats. Multi-cloud architecture specialists who can design and manage environments spanning multiple cloud providers simultaneously command premiums that reflect the genuine difficulty of this technical challenge and the growing prevalence of multi-cloud strategies among large enterprises. Cloud architects who have developed strong machine learning infrastructure expertise — designing the cloud environments that support artificial intelligence model training and deployment — access compensation ranges at the upper end of the mid-career market reflecting the intersection of two exceptionally scarce skill domains.

Senior Cloud Architect Earnings Potential At The Peak Of Technical Expertise

Senior cloud architects in India who have accumulated a decade or more of technology experience with substantial cloud architecture practice represent the most technically mature and consequently best-compensated segment of the cloud architecture talent pool. These professionals have typically led multiple large-scale cloud transformation programs, developed reusable architectural frameworks and reference architectures used across organizational portfolios, mentored and developed more junior cloud professionals, and built the credibility with senior organizational leadership that allows their architectural recommendations to carry genuine strategic weight. Annual compensation packages for senior cloud architects in India’s premium technology employment markets — particularly Bangalore, which hosts the highest concentration of global technology company India operations — commonly range from forty lakhs to eighty lakhs per annum for professionals with genuinely strong credentials and track records.

The upper reaches of senior cloud architect compensation in India — packages exceeding sixty or seventy lakhs annually — are concentrated among professionals who combine exceptional technical depth with characteristics that distinguish genuine thought leaders from highly competent practitioners. Published technical contributions including conference presentations, technical blog writing, open-source project leadership, and participation in cloud vendor advisory programs all contribute to a professional profile that signals thought leadership value beyond organizational implementation work. Senior cloud architects who have demonstrated the ability to lead large, complex transformation programs involving significant organizational change management alongside technical delivery command the premium compensation that reflects the rarity of this combined technical and leadership capability. These professionals are frequently recruited directly by executive technology leaders rather than through standard hiring processes, reflecting the recognition that identifying and securing this caliber of cloud architecture talent requires relationship-based approaches rather than mass market recruitment methods.

How Cloud Platform Specialization Influences Earning Potential Across Indian Markets

The specific cloud platform or platforms on which a cloud architect has developed their deepest expertise has a meaningful influence on compensation outcomes in the Indian market, reflecting the varying levels of enterprise adoption, competitive talent dynamics, and market demand associated with each platform. Amazon Web Services maintains the largest market share in the Indian enterprise cloud market and consequently supports the largest absolute number of cloud architect employment opportunities, creating a broad job market for AWS-certified cloud architects. However, the relatively larger talent pool of AWS-certified professionals in India compared to other platforms means that compensation premiums for AWS expertise, while still strong, are somewhat less extreme than those associated with platforms where the ratio of demand to qualified supply is more dramatically imbalanced.

Microsoft Azure has developed particularly strong penetration in India’s enterprise market through its integration with Microsoft’s broader productivity and enterprise software ecosystem, and Azure-specialized cloud architects command excellent compensation that reflects both strong demand from enterprises running hybrid Microsoft environments and the genuine technical depth required to architect complex Azure deployments effectively. Google Cloud Platform specialization commands some of the strongest compensation premiums in the Indian market at present, reflecting the platform’s rapid enterprise adoption growth combined with a talent pool that has not yet scaled to match the pace of demand expansion. Multi-platform expertise — validated through professional-level certifications across two or three major cloud providers and demonstrated through practical experience designing and managing environments spanning multiple platforms — consistently commands the highest compensation premium of any cloud architecture specialization, reflecting the genuine scarcity and high organizational value of professionals who can provide platform-agnostic architectural guidance based on deep knowledge of each major cloud ecosystem.

The Impact Of Industry Sector On Cloud Architect Compensation In India

Cloud architect compensation in India varies meaningfully across industry sectors, reflecting differences in the strategic importance organizations assign to cloud infrastructure, the regulatory complexity of their cloud environments, the maturity of their cloud adoption journeys, and the financial resources available to compete for specialized technology talent. The financial services sector — encompassing banking, insurance, capital markets, and fintech organizations — consistently offers among the highest cloud architect compensation in the Indian market, driven by the combination of strict regulatory requirements that demand sophisticated cloud security and compliance architectures, the business-critical nature of financial system availability, and the financial resources of large banking and financial institutions to compete aggressively for the specialized talent required to design and manage their complex cloud environments.

The technology product sector, including both global technology companies with India development centers and Indian software product companies building cloud-native applications, offers compensation that rivals financial services for cloud architects who combine infrastructure expertise with strong software engineering foundations and experience designing cloud environments optimized for software delivery at scale. Healthcare technology, e-commerce, telecommunications, and manufacturing sectors have all accelerated their cloud adoption significantly in recent years, creating growing demand for cloud architecture expertise in organizational environments that offer interesting technical challenges alongside the stability and comprehensive benefits packages that characterize large enterprise employers. Government and public sector cloud adoption, while more constrained by procurement processes and compensation structures than private sector equivalents, is creating a growing set of cloud architecture opportunities for professionals interested in contributing to national digital infrastructure modernization with a different kind of meaningful organizational impact than commercial sector roles typically provide.

Hyderabad And Pune As Rising Competitors In The Cloud Architecture Salary Market

While Bangalore maintains overall market leadership in cloud architecture compensation, Hyderabad and Pune have emerged as increasingly significant and competitive cloud architecture employment markets that offer compelling combinations of professional opportunity and quality of life that attract growing numbers of technology professionals. Hyderabad has benefited enormously from substantial investments by major global technology companies including Microsoft, which operates one of its largest India campuses in the city, alongside Google, Amazon, Apple, and numerous other technology firms that have established significant Hyderabad presences. These investments have created a cloud architecture talent market that increasingly rivals Bangalore in both the quality and compensation levels of available opportunities, while offering a cost of living that remains somewhat more manageable than Bangalore’s increasingly expensive housing and transportation environment.

Pune’s cloud architecture employment market has developed through a combination of proximity to Mumbai’s large enterprise market, the presence of major technology services companies including Infosys, Wipro, Cognizant, and Capgemini with substantial Pune operations, and a growing cluster of product companies and startups that have chosen Pune for its strong engineering talent pipeline from institutions including the College of Engineering Pune and Symbiosis Institute of Technology. Cloud architects in Pune and Hyderabad typically command compensation packages that are somewhat below the equivalent Bangalore market rate — commonly in the range of eighty to ninety percent of comparable Bangalore packages — but this differential is partially or fully offset by lower living costs, generally shorter commutes, and in many cases a quality of life that technology professionals with family priorities find more sustainable than Bangalore’s increasingly congested and expensive urban environment.

Remote Work Opportunities And Their Influence On Cloud Architect Compensation

The normalization of remote work across the global technology industry has created significant implications for cloud architect compensation dynamics within India. The most immediate and financially significant impact has been the emergence of genuine opportunities for India-based cloud architects to work for international organizations — particularly companies based in the United States, United Kingdom, and European markets — while remaining physically located in India. These international remote opportunities offer compensation benchmarked against overseas employment markets rather than the Indian domestic market, creating packages that can reach two to five times what equivalent domestic Indian roles offer, while allowing professionals to maintain the lifestyle and family connections associated with living in India.

Accessing these international remote opportunities typically requires a combination of technical credentials that meet or exceed international market standards, English communication skills that function effectively in distributed global team environments, and sufficient professional reputation or network visibility to be discoverable by international employers who are not actively recruiting in the Indian market through traditional channels. Cloud architects who invest in building international professional visibility through technical blogging, open-source contributions, conference speaking, and active participation in global cloud community forums create the professional profile that attracts international remote opportunities organically. The domestic remote work market has also expanded considerably, with many Indian technology employers offering cloud architects the flexibility to work from locations outside their primary office city — enabling professionals based in smaller cities or seeking lifestyle-driven location changes to access compensation levels previously available only to those willing to relocate to major technology hub cities.

Negotiation Strategies That Help Cloud Architects Maximize Their Compensation Outcomes

Understanding compensation market dynamics is a prerequisite for effective salary negotiation, but knowledge alone is insufficient — cloud architects who achieve the best compensation outcomes combine market awareness with specific negotiation strategies and the professional confidence to advocate effectively for their own market value. The first and most foundational negotiation strategy is developing accurate and current knowledge of the specific compensation range for your combination of experience, specialization, certifications, and target employer type. Salary data from sources including professional community surveys, recruiter conversations, peer network discussions, and published compensation reports provides the factual basis for negotiating from a position of informed confidence rather than uncertainty or assumption.

Timing and framing are equally important dimensions of compensation negotiation for cloud architects. Negotiating from a position of multiple competing offers is significantly more advantageous than negotiating from a position of needing a single offer to materialize, making the investment of time required to pursue multiple opportunities simultaneously a financially worthwhile strategy even for professionals who have a strong preference for a specific employer. Articulating your value in terms of specific business outcomes your architectural decisions have produced — measurable improvements in system reliability, quantified cost optimization achievements, successful delivery of complex transformation programs — creates a more compelling negotiation foundation than discussing skills and certifications in the abstract. Cloud architects who frame their compensation discussions around the value they will create for the organization rather than the compensation they need for personal financial reasons consistently achieve better negotiation outcomes across both initial offers and subsequent performance review discussions.
